## Nightlode v2.4.1

Scheduler now staggers nightly backfill jobs by shard instead of launching all at once. Fixes the 02:00 thundering-herd against the Corvax warehouse. Added jitter (0–90s) and a per-shard concurrency cap of 4. Retry backoff is exponential, capped at 30m. Dropped the legacy `--force-serial` flag; config migration runs automatically on first start. Tests cover shard assignment and cap enforcement. Review the lock-acquisition path carefully before merge. Ownership for this change follows below.

account owner for bawip-tahag: Raleth Quenok

CI note — Givewire receipt mailer

The donation-receipt mailer job fails intermittently on stage. Cause: template compiler races the locale bundle fetch; when the bundle lands late, rendering aborts with a missing-string error. Workaround: rerun the job once — second pass always green. Permanent fix lands in the next Givewire sprint; do not block the release on this. Retries are capped at two to avoid duplicate sends. Verify the passing run matches the build stamp shown below.

pipeline stamp: htk6_7941f2

## TICKET-2087: Cron drift — vault access blocked

For the weekly sync: the Tidewheel scheduler is drifting roughly four minutes per day, and the investigation stalled because the diagnostics vault sealed itself after the Orvane cluster restart. We need the timing logs inside it to confirm the NTP hypothesis before Thursday. Recovery requires two reviewers present and an audit note filed. Once both are logged, unseal the vault using the passphrase recorded below.

vault phrase of yawip-hahag = aldok-fraius-quenmir-casvan-aldius-ulaax-zorius-holion-zoreth-weniel-tamys-lamix-wenath-weniel